Sylvatic plague has been confirmed in prairie dog colonies at Soapstone Prairie Natural Area. The disease is spread by fleas. Please use precautions similar to those for West Nile virus and ticks – stay on designated trails, avoid contact with wildlife, and use DEET-based insect repellent.
